Direct answer

Red-White-Red Card for Start-up GründerInnen (start-up founders). Requires establishing an innovative company with products/services/processes/technologies, consistent business plan, personal controlling influence, capital of at least €30,000 with at least 50% equity share, and minimum 50/85 points covering qualification, work experience, language, age, and bonus points (additional €50,000 capital, business incubator admission, age under 35).

Can I bring my family on the Red-White-Red Card for Start-up Founders?

Yes, this pathway allows family members including dependents. Your spouse may also be eligible to work.

Can the Red-White-Red Card for Start-up Founders lead to permanent residency?

Yes — this pathway can lead to permanent residence, subject to meeting the residence and other conditions. We do not publish a qualifying timeline for this route because we have no official source stating one; check with the relevant authority for the current residence requirement.
